A42MX36-1PQG208M Description
The A42MX36-1PQG208M is a high-performance Field Programmable Gate Array (FPGA) from Microchip Technology, designed for versatile applications requiring significant computational power and flexibility. This IC features a robust set of technical specifications that make it suitable for a wide range of embedded systems. With 176 I/O pins and a total of 2560 RAM bits, the A42MX36-1PQG208M offers substantial memory and connectivity options. It supports a dual voltage supply range of 3V to 3.6V and 4.5V to 5.5V, ensuring compatibility with various power requirements. The device is housed in a 208-pin QFP package, making it ideal for surface-mount applications. The A42MX36-1PQG208M is part of the MX series, known for its reliability and performance. It boasts 54,000 logic gates, providing ample processing capacity for complex tasks. The product is REACH unaffected and RoHS3 compliant, adhering to stringent environmental standards. With a moisture sensitivity level (MSL) of 3 (168 hours), it is well-suited for environments with varying humidity levels.
